Museo Orlina, A Glass Act
Tagaytay remains my all-time favorite travel destination in the Philippines. Nothing beats it for a quick getaway from Metro Manila to escape smog and gridlock. The scenic drive along Tagaytay ridge for that breathtaking view – Taal lake with the volcano crater at its core – never gets old. The higher elevation’s exhilarating breeze cooled us during our trip even if it was a hot summer day.

Pictorial: Tagaytay, Davao and Bacolod Revisited
One of my favorite hangouts in the Philippines is Antonio’s in Tagaytay. This is Chef Tony Boy Escalante’s fine dining restaurant. Set away from the busy tourist area of Tagaytay, the magnificent Antonio’s is a sight to behold in this rural setting. The last time I was here was ten years ago. I would have come sooner and more frequently, had I not been forewarned about the traffic.

Tagaytay: One of the Best Tourist Destinations in Asia
Tagaytay City can be found in the Province of Cavite. Tagaytay is the second summer capital of the Philippines, next to Baguio. Tagaytay with its cold climate and overwhelming beauty, Tagaytay City is helps boom the tourism in the Philippines, especially in summer. Tagaytay City is situated 2,500 feet above sea level.
